Where is Bac Son and Mau Son Lang Son?

Bac Son Valley, located in Bac Son District, Lang Son Province, is a picturesque area surrounded by towering limestone mountains and lush rice fields. The valley is just 160 kilometers north of Hanoi, making it an ideal weekend getaway for motorbike enthusiasts looking to escape the hustle and bustle of the capital.

Mau Son, a mountain range in Lang Son Province, is famous for its cool climate, stunning views, and rich cultural heritage. Known as the “Alps of Vietnam,” Mau Son is located about 30 kilometers from Lang Son city, offering riders the perfect mix of challenging roads, historical landmarks, and tranquil mountain air.

Why Ride to Bac Son and Mau Son Lang Son?

  • Dramatic Landscapes: Bac Son Valley offers sweeping views of rice fields nestled between jagged mountains, while Mau Son is known for its mist-covered peaks and deep valleys.

  • Rich Cultural Encounters: The area is home to the Tay, H’mong, and Dao people, giving you the chance to experience Vietnam’s diverse ethnic cultures.

  • Adventure and Challenge: The terrain features winding mountain roads, dirt trails, and serene backroads that challenge even the most experienced motorbike riders.

  • Historical Insights: Bac Son Valley played a key role in Vietnam’s history, particularly during the resistance against French colonial forces.

What to Expect from the Ride to Bac Son and Mau Son Lang Son?

Terrain and Roads

The motorcycle tour to Bac Son and Mau Son Lang Son is an adventure that mixes paved roads with dirt trails. Riders will navigate mountain passes, narrow roads flanked by dense forests, and scenic rural paths. The route offers both on-road and off-road sections, ideal for experienced riders or those with a bit of motorbike riding experience.

Climate

  • Summer (April to August): Warm temperatures with some rain, especially in the afternoon. It’s still an excellent time for riding, as the lush green landscapes are at their peak.

  • Winter (November to February): Cooler temperatures, particularly in Mau Son, where you might experience chilly winds and mist. This is also the best time for those who love the misty, serene mountain views.

  • Best Time to Visit: September to November is ideal for a smooth ride with good weather conditions, while avoiding the wet season.

Local Culture and Ethnic Traditions

Bac Son and Mau Son are home to a rich tapestry of Vietnam’s ethnic minorities. The Tay, H’mong, Dao, and Nung people have lived in this region for centuries. Their customs, language, and art are woven into the fabric of daily life. Visitors will encounter traditional stilt houses, vibrant festivals, and local markets selling handcrafted goods.

The local culture is deeply influenced by the agricultural lifestyle, with rice paddies and terraced fields dotting the landscape. Stopping at villages during your motorcycle tour to Bac Son and Mau Son Lang Son will provide you with a unique opportunity to witness these traditions firsthand.

Culinary Delights Along the Way

The cuisine of Bac Son and Mau Son is heavily influenced by the region’s natural resources. Here are some must-try dishes during your journey:

  • Bánh cuốn: Rice rolls stuffed with minced pork, served with a side of fresh herbs and dipping sauce.

  • Bánh ngô: Corn cake made from fresh, locally grown corn.

  • Thắng cố: A traditional dish of the H’mong people made with horse meat, perfect for a hearty meal after a long ride.

  • Grilled fish and wild vegetables: Freshly caught from local rivers, these dishes are perfect for a quick roadside meal.

How to Get to Bac Son and Mau Son Lang Son by Motorcycle

  • From Hanoi: Head north on National Road 3 towards Bac Son and then continue to Mau Son. The total distance is around 160 kilometers, taking 4–5 hours by motorbike.

FAQs About Vietnam Motorcycle Tour to Bac Son and Mau Son Lang Son

❓What is the difficulty level of the Bac Son and Mau Son route?

The route is moderately difficult, with a combination of paved and dirt roads. It is recommended for intermediate to experienced riders.

❓How long does it take to ride from Hanoi to Bac Son and Mau Son?

The journey typically takes about 4 to 5 hours by motorbike, depending on the speed and the number of stops along the way.

❓What should I bring for the motorcycle tour?

Make sure to bring comfortable riding gear, water-resistant clothing (in case of rain), and a camera for the stunning views. A first-aid kit and spare motorbike parts are also recommended.

❓Is it safe to ride in Bac Son and Mau Son?

Yes, the route is generally safe for experienced riders. However, riders should be cautious on mountain roads, as they can be narrow and winding.
